摘要:针对TPWallet(或同类智能钱包)哪种授权方式更安全,本文从便捷支付服务、合约案例、专家预测、全球化数字革命、弹性设计与高性能数据存储六个角度详尽分析,给出可落地的组合授权建议。

1. 授权类型与安全权衡
常见授权包括私钥直接签名、助记词恢复、硬件钱包(HSM/TREZOR)、多重签名(Multisig)、门限签名(MPC)、合约钱包(smart contract wallet,含社交恢复和session keys)以及基于权限的Token allowance(approve/permit)。安全性从高到低大致为:硬件+MPC/多签+合约钱包(具备社保/回收)> 单设备私钥。便捷性通常与权重相反,因此推荐混合方案。
2. 便捷支付服务
为了消费级体验,TPWallet可引入会话密钥(session keys)与EIP-2612/712式离线签名(permit)实现“一次授权,多次支付”的 UX,同时用Paymaster/元交易(meta-transaction)在用户无需持ETH时完成gas支付。前端应透明展示权限范围与有效期,提供一键撤销与最小授权额度,平衡便捷与最小权限原则。
3. 合约案例解析
- ERC20 approve vs permit:permit(EIP-2612)用离线签名替代链上approve,减少批准攻击窗口。- Gnosis Safe:成熟的多签合约实例,适用于高净值或机构账户。- ERC-4337/Account Abstraction:将逻辑放入合约钱包,支持社会恢复、定时锁与支付委托。- EIP-1271:合约签名验证,适用于合约托管的授权验证。
4. 专家分析与未来预测
专家趋势判断:更多采用“合约钱包+门限签名+账户抽象(AA)”组合。MPC与多签在适配传统合规与托管场景会扩大市场,零知识验证将用于隐私保护与权限审计。监管方向会推动KYC层与可审计的权限撤回机制并存。

5. 全球化数字革命与合规性
跨境支付、CBDC 与稳定币的兴起要求钱包具备可插拔合规模块(如选择性披露、审计日志)。去中心化与全球化并非对立:通过可验证日志与隐私保护技术(ZK)既可满足监管要求,又不损伤用户主权。
6. 弹性与高可用性设计
弹性体现在密钥恢复、灾备与权限最小化。推荐:阈值签名备份(M-of-N)、社交恢复作为二级恢复手段、冷/热通道分离、离线冷钱包定期签名策略。权限撤销要即时生效,合约层设计应支持紧急熔断与时限锁定。
7. 高性能数据存储策略
交易证明与审计日志建议链上存哈希,详实数据放到去中心化存储(IPFS/Arweave)或受信任的分层数据库(Layer-2 Rollup、中心化备份加加密)。对延迟敏感的支付路径可采用轻客户端+缓存策略,确保吞吐与安全并重。
综合建议(可落地方案):构建以合约钱包为中心的授权框架,主签名采用门限签名(MPC)或多签,启用session keys与EIP-712签名以提高便捷度,支持permit以减少链上approve暴露窗口;引入元交易Paymaster改善支付体验;所有授权操作记录链上哈希并在去中心化存储加密备份;提供一键撤销、阈值恢复与紧急熔断;并为合规/跨境场景准备选择性披露与审计接口。
结论:没有单一“最安全”的授权方式,最佳实践是多层次、可组合的授权体系:合约钱包+门限签名/多签+会话/permit+高可用备份与可审计存储,既能提供消费级便捷支付,也能满足机构/全球化场景下的安全与合规需求。
评论
小明
这篇分析很全面,特别认同合约钱包加MPC的组合思路。
CryptoFan87
建议里提到的session keys和paymaster对用户体验提升很有帮助,期待更多实现案例。
区块链小白
语言通俗易懂,合约钱包是什么可以举个更具体的示例吗?
Satoshi_L
赞同把审计哈希链上存储的方案,兼顾隐私与可追溯性,很务实。